php 寫入.csv文件注意點

更多內容: http://blog.yuhai.win

1、http://witmax.cn/php-write-csv.html

2、http://blog.csdn.net/hiking_tsang/article/details/51735889

PHP生成CSV時的遇到的問題

1、帶前導0的文本數據被視爲數字而不顯示前面的0了,如學號09210110011顯示成了9210110011

2、日期格式數據被自動做了顯示處理,如2009-10-17 08:43:40顯示成了2009-10-17 8:43

3、文本數據中的半角逗號(,)被視爲字段分隔符導致單元格數據錯位

4、文本數據中帶有回車符,被視爲數據行分隔符導致數據錯誤



解決辦法:

1、使用 =”數據” 的方式可以避免智能解析,能夠解決第一條和第二條問題的發生

2、使用 “” 法可以避免錯誤分割數據 解決 3、4 的問題

其他解決方案:

3、在數字前面加上製表符 如055555 則生成時爲\t0555

4、在數字前面加上英文的 單引號 “’”


發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章